These eight discounts can lower your car insurance quotes

Some insurers don’t list every policy discount in an easy-to-find place, so the following list contains a few of the more common and also the more inconspicuous credits that you can use to lower your rates.

  • Passive Restraints and Air Bags – Factory options such as air bags may earn rate discounts up to 30%.
  • Multi-Vehicle Discounts – Buying a policy with all your vehicles on one policy could earn a price break for each car.
  • Driver Safety – Participating in a course that instructs on driving safety may get you a small discount if you qualify.
  • Drive Less and Save – Low mileage vehicles could qualify for lower rates due to less chance of an accident.
  • Payment Method – If you pay your bill all at once instead of paying each month you may reduce your total bill.
  • ABS and Traction Control Discounts – Cars and trucks that have anti-lock braking systems have fewer accidents and will save you 10% or more.
  • 55 and Retired – Older drivers are able to get a slight reduction on a .
  • Include Life Insurance and Save – Some car insurance companies give a small discount if you purchase some life insurance in addition to your auto policy.

Don’t be surprised that some of the credits will not apply to the overall cost of the policy. A few only apply to the cost of specific coverages such as liability and collision coverage. So when the math indicates all the discounts add up to a free policy, nobody gets a free ride.

But they said I’d save $457 a year!

Consumers can’t escape the ads that claim the best rates from companies such as State Farm, Geico and Progressive. All the ads tend to make the same promise that drivers can save some big amount if you get a free and switch your policy.compare rates in Kernersville North Carolina

But how can every company sell you cheaper insurance coverage? This is the trick they use.

Many companies have underwriting criteria for the type of driver that will generate a profit. A good example of a profitable insured may need to be between the ages of 30 and 50, carries full coverage, and has great credit. A customer getting a price quote that hits that “sweet spot” receive the lowest rate quotes and therefore will save if they switch.

Insureds who do not match these criteria may receive a more expensive rate with the end result being business going elsewhere. If you listen to the ad wording, they say “drivers who switch” but not “all drivers who get quotes” will save that much if they switch. This is how companies can lure you into getting a quote.

This really illustrates why it is so important to do a quote comparison often. It’s just not possible to know the company that will fit your personal profile best.

Coverages available on your policy

Understanding the coverages of your car insurance policy helps when choosing the best coverages and the correct deductibles and limits. The coverage terms in a policy can be impossible to understand and reading a policy is terribly boring.

Comprehensive protection – Comprehensive insurance will pay to fix damage from a wide range of events other than collision. You need to pay your deductible first and the remainder of the damage will be paid by comprehensive coverage.

Comprehensive coverage protects against things like theft, vandalism and a broken windshield. The maximum amount you can receive from a comprehensive claim is the market value of your vehicle, so if the vehicle is not worth much it’s probably time to drop comprehensive insurance.

Collision – Collision coverage pays for damage to your vehicle resulting from colliding with a stationary object or other vehicle. You have to pay a deductible then your collision coverage will kick in.

Collision coverage protects against claims such as backing into a parked car, colliding with another moving vehicle and crashing into a ditch. Collision is rather expensive coverage, so consider removing coverage from vehicles that are 8 years or older. Drivers also have the option to raise the deductible to get cheaper collision coverage.

Liability coverages – This coverage protects you from injuries or damage you cause to people or other property that is your fault. It protects YOU against claims from other people. It does not cover damage sustained by your vehicle in an accident.

It consists of three limits, bodily injury per person, bodily injury per accident and property damage. You commonly see liability limits of 50/100/50 that means you have $50,000 in coverage for each person’s injuries, a limit of $100,000 in injury protection per accident, and $50,000 of coverage for damaged propery. Occasionally you may see a combined single limit or CSL which combines the three limits into one amount rather than limiting it on a per person basis.

Liability coverage pays for claims such as emergency aid, bail bonds, pain and suffering and funeral expenses. The amount of liability coverage you purchase is a decision to put some thought into, but it’s cheap coverage so purchase as high a limit as you can afford. North Carolina requires minimum liability limits of 30,000/60,000/25,000 but you should consider buying more coverage.

Uninsured or underinsured coverage – Uninsured or Underinsured Motorist coverage provides protection from other motorists when they either are underinsured or have no liability coverage at all. Covered losses include hospital bills for your injuries and also any damage incurred to your vehicle.

Due to the fact that many North Carolina drivers only carry the minimum required liability limits (30/60/25 in North Carolina), it only takes a small accident to exceed their coverage. So UM/UIM coverage is a good idea. Frequently these coverages are identical to your policy’s liability coverage.

Medical expense coverage – Medical payments and Personal Injury Protection insurance kick in for immediate expenses such as X-ray expenses, prosthetic devices, doctor visits and EMT expenses. They are used to cover expenses not covered by your health insurance policy or if you are not covered by health insurance. It covers both the driver and occupants and will also cover being hit by a car walking across the street. PIP is not an option in every state and may carry a deductible

Compare but don’t skimp

Lower-priced car insurance is attainable online and with local Kernersville insurance agents, and you should compare rates from both to get a complete price analysis. Some insurance providers don’t offer the ability to get quotes online and many times these smaller companies only sell through independent agencies.

As you prepare to switch companies, it’s not a good idea to buy lower coverage limits just to save a few bucks. There have been many situations where an insured dropped physical damage coverage and learned later that the small savings ended up costing them much more. Your strategy should be to buy enough coverage at a price you can afford, not the least amount of coverage.
